Next.js, the popular React framework for building fast and scalable web applications, is set to release Next.js 15, bringing new features, improvements, and optimizations. Whether you’re a developer looking to enhance your web performance or a business aiming for a seamless user experience, Next.js 15 is shaping up to be a game-changer.
In this article, we’ll explore what Next.js 15 has to offer, its expected features, and how it improves upon previous versions.
What is Next.js?
Next.js is a React-based framework developed by Vercel that allows developers to build server-side rendered (SSR), static, and hybrid web applications. It is known for its performance, ease of use, and built-in features like API routes, automatic image optimization, and incremental static regeneration (ISR).
With each new release, Next.js continues to refine its performance, developer experience, and scalability. Next.js 15 is expected to introduce further optimizations to streamline modern web development.
Expected Features of Next.js 15
1. Enhanced Server Components
Next.js has been progressively improving React Server Components (RSC) to enhance performance by reducing JavaScript bundle sizes. In Next.js 15, we expect further optimizations that allow faster server-side rendering, reducing load times and improving overall efficiency.
2. Better Edge Functions Integration
With Vercel’s continuous push towards Edge Functions, Next.js 15 may introduce improvements that allow faster execution of server-side logic at the edge, reducing latency and improving response times for global users.
3. Improved Routing with App Router
Next.js 14 introduced the App Router, a significant upgrade to its routing system. Next.js 15 is expected to refine this further, making it even easier for developers to build scalable, modular applications with better route handling and nested layouts.
4. Advanced Image and Asset Optimization
Next.js already includes automatic image optimization, but version 15 is likely to enhance this feature with better compression algorithms and support for new formats, ensuring faster image loading without compromising quality.
5. Enhanced Caching and Performance Optimizations
Next.js continuously improves its caching mechanisms to reduce redundant server requests and improve performance. In Next.js 15, developers can expect smarter caching strategies, leading to faster page loads and reduced server costs.
6. AI-Powered Enhancements
Vercel has been integrating AI-powered developer tools into its platform. Next.js 15 might bring better AI-assisted code suggestions, optimizations, and debugging features, making development faster and more efficient.
7. Better DX (Developer Experience) Improvements
Each Next.js update focuses on making the developer experience (DX) smoother. Expect improvements in error handling, debugging tools, and TypeScript support in Next.js 15, making it even easier for developers to work with the framework.
Why Upgrade to Next.js 15?
If you’re already using Next.js, upgrading to version 15 can offer multiple benefits:
-
Faster Performance – Optimized server-side rendering and caching improvements.
-
Better Scalability – More efficient routing and handling of large applications.
-
Enhanced Security – Regular updates ensure vulnerabilities are patched.
-
Improved Developer Experience – New tools and debugging enhancements.
-
Future-Proofing – Stay ahead with the latest features and integrations.
How to Upgrade to Next.js 15
Once Next.js 15 is officially released, upgrading your project is straightforward:
-
Update the Next.js Package
Run the following command in your project:or using yarn:
-
Check for Breaking Changes
Review the Next.js 15 migration guide (available upon release) to ensure compatibility with your existing code. -
Test Your Application
Run your project locally to check for any unexpected behavior and test new features.
Conclusion
Next.js 15 is set to bring powerful improvements, from faster server components to better caching and AI-powered enhancements. Whether you’re building a small website or a large-scale web application, upgrading to Next.js 15 can significantly improve your project’s performance and scalability.
Stay tuned for the official release and start preparing your applications to take advantage of the latest features! 🚀
